Areas of Study

Exploring the World with Your Child

Practical

This area focuses on self-care, environmental care, social interactions, and etiquette to lay the groundwork for independence and life skills. Children learn through hands-on activities like dressing, sweeping, and gardening to promote responsibility and community awareness.

Sensorial

Designed to refine the senses, sensory activities help children distinguish differences in size, shape, colour, texture, and sound. These exercises enhance perception and intelligence to prepare them for more complex learning.

Mathematics

Our math curriculum introduces basic numeracy and progresses to more advanced concepts using tangible materials. Children explore patterns, sequences, and relationships, moving from concrete to abstract mathematical understanding.

Cultural Studies

Children discover geography, history, nature, and science to connect with the world around them. Activities include using geographical materials, observing seasonal changes, and celebrating cultural diversity.

Language

Beginning with phonetics and tactile letter recognition, language activities evolve into reading and writing. Through engaging with letters, sounds, and words, children develop strong literacy skills. We also offer Spanish lessons to our kindergarten group to enhance their cultural understanding.
